2024-25:Â Appeared in all 37 games as a sophomore...tallied eight goals and 15 assists for 23 points to rank second on the team in scoring...ranked second on the team in shots (84)...tallied a season-high eight shots and also blocked a season-best four against Robert Morris (9/27) ... recorded three assists in a two-game weekend series at RMU (9/27-28) ... scored a pair of goals against Penn State (10/12) ... had five assists in a three-game span against Dartmouth (10/26), Cornell (11/1) and Colgate (11/2) ... scored the eventual game-winner in the second period to clinch a Mayors' Cup victory over Rensselaer (1/25) ... scored in back-to-back games against Cornell (2/8) and Princeton (2/14).

2023-24: Lone first-year to appear in all 35 games…scored 12 goals and added seven assists for 19 points…12 goals led team while 19 points were second-most…picked up first career point off an assist on first Union goal at Messa Rink in 2023-24 in win over Robert Morris (9/29)...first three collegiate goals came in dramatic fashion, potting hat trick capped off with overtime winner against Holy Cross (10/7)...performance earned her ECAC Hockey Rookie of the Week honors (10/10)...five goals and eight points in first month and change of the season got her ECAC Hockey Rookie of the Month (end of September/October)...also scored game-winner against Penn State (1/5) in overtime to secure program’s second ever win over a ranked opponent and Harvard (10/20) to clinch victory in ECAC opener for first time since 2017…had a four-game point streak (2-2-4) from 10/14-10/27…registered four multi-point outings.
Prior to Union: Played for RINK Hockey Academy Kelowna in 2022-23…averaged nearly a point per game in the regular season with 13 goals and 16 assists for 29 points in 30 games…then added four goals and three assists in five postseason games to help RHA Kelowna to a U18 Prep Championship…also led Team British Columbia with seven goals and five assists in six games to capture the province’s first gold medal at the 2023 Canada Winter Games.
